摘要
目的探讨个体化发泡胶联合颈胸膜固定在中下段食管癌放射治疗中的应用。方法选取在医院放疗科接受放射治疗的60例中下段食管癌患者,根据不同的体位固定方式分为个体化发泡胶联合颈胸膜固定组(A组)和应用发泡胶联合体部热塑膜固定组(B组),每组30例。采用Varian TrueBeam直线加速器的锥形束CT(Cone Beam CT,CBCT)对每例患者进行扫描采集,第1周前3次和后续每周1次,并与计划CT图像进行配准对比,通过软组织配准和人工校对得出左右、头脚、腹背三个方向的线性位移数据。比较两组摆位误差的不同以及根据靶区运动的大小,得出靶区外扩边界的距离。结果每组各30例,A组CBCT共210人次,B组CBCT共205人次,A、B两组在左右(X轴)、头脚(Y轴)、腹背(Z轴)方向的摆位误差分别为:(0.059±1.938)mm与(0.259±2.168)mm(P=0.227)、(0.950±1.883)mm与(0.315±2.806)mm(P<0.05)、(0.723±1.543)mm与(1.004±2.159)mm(P<0.05)。AB两组在X、Y、Z三个方向的外扩边界(MPTV)距离分别为4.21mm和4.72mm、4.27mm和6.12mm、3.32mm和4.50mm。结论对于需要放疗中下段的食管癌患者,使用个体化发泡胶联合颈胸膜固定方式在Y轴和Z轴方向上明显优于发泡胶联合体部热塑膜固定方式,摆位精度和重复性明显提升。同时得出中下段的食管癌靶区三个方向的外扩边界,对于临床治疗有一定的参考意义。
Objective Exploring the application of personalized foam adhesive combined with cervical pleural fixation in radiotherapy for middle and lower esophageal cancer.Methods Sixty patients with middle and lower segment esophageal cancer who received radiotherapy in the radiotherapy department of the hospital were selected and divided into individual styrofoam combined with cervical pleural fixation group(group A)and styrofoam combined with thermoplastic film fixation group(group B)according to different postural fixation methods,with 30 cases in each group.Cone Beam CT(CBCT)of Varian TrueBeam linear accelerator was used for scanning collection of each patient,three times before the first week and once a week thereafter,and the registration was compared with the planned CT images.The linear displacement data of left and right,head and foot,abdomen and back were obtained by soft tissue registration and manual calibration.By comparing the difference of the two sets of positioning errors and the size of the target area movement,the distance of the outer boundary of the target area is obtained.Results There are 30 cases in each group,with a total of 210 CBCTs in Group A and 205 CBCTs in Group B.The positioning errors in the left and right(X-axis),head and foot(Y-axis),and abdominal and dorsal(Z-axis)directions of Groups A and B are(0.059±1.938)mm and(0.259±2.168)mm(P=0.227),(0.950±1.883)mm and(0.315±2.806)mm(P<0.05),(0.723±1.543)mm and(1.004±2.159)mm(P<0.05),respectively.The MPTV distances of AB and AB groups in the X,Y,and Z directions are 4.21mm and 4.72mm,4.27mm and 6.12mm,3.32mm and 4.50mm,respectively.Conclusion For patients with esophageal cancer requiring radiotherapy in the middle and lower segments,the use of individualized foam adhesive combined with cervical pleural fixation is significantly superior to the use of thermoplastic film in the combination of foam adhesive in the Y and Z axis directions,and the positioning accuracy and repeatability are significantly improved.At the same time,the boundary of three directions of the target area of esophageal cancer in the middle and lower segment was obtained,which has certain reference significance for clinical treatment.
